Description Direct Docs Feedback 2023-08-07 17:04:50 UTC
Chapter 7 and 8 about running OpenSCAP is still heavily focused on the use of Puppet. Please update the docs for 6.11 and up as described on https://access.redhat.com/solutions/4557961 and the accompanying video. Each section should be split into a Puppet and Ansible based setup.
Potentially adding a manual section as well since that appears to be an option when defining a Policy.
